During the height of the COVID-19 pandemic, particularly between June and August 2020, the task team was entrusted with organizing specialized training in bioinformatics. This training was especially intended at pupils from the research team Center for Research study in Applied Computer at the Federal University of Pará (UFRA) The adaptation to remote learning platforms due to the pandemic produced a chance to explore new teaching methods and electronic tools that improved both reach and efficiency.
This course was created to offer an accessible yet comprehensive review of Artificial Intelligence techniques, especially as applied in bioinformatics (Bioinformatics Tutor). This digital format allowed participation from students across Brazil, many of whom might not have had the opportunity to go to in-person sessions.
Bioinformatics Tutor for Beginners
A significant feature of this course was its emphasis on hands-on learning. About 50% of the overall training hours were committed to functional tasks where trainees developed intelligent versions and applications in a variety of scientific domain names, consisting of genes, molecular biology, and environmental data analysis. Commonly used structures and tools such as Spyder, Google Colab, Jupyter Notebooks, and Orange were integrated right into the coursework. These platforms enabled trainees to participate in real-time data manipulation, model training, and algorithm experimentation.

The training initiative formed part of a broader academic outreach effort referred to as the Bioinformatics when driving task. This job has, for many years, presented dozens of trainees to the world of bioinformatics and computational biology. The events held under this umbrella initiative have occurred throughout numerous areas and years, as summed up in Table 1 (Listing of occasions, locations, years, go to this web-site and total varieties of pupils and instructors)
One of the most amazing outcomes of the Bioinformatics when traveling effort has actually been its contribution to the growth of decentralized research study teams. Numerous of these groups, originally united by their involvement in training occasions, have considering that gone on to create independent scientific research in partnership with local academic institutions. The training not only promoted clinical reasoning within the context of bioinformatics but also sparked collective connections that expanded past the training setting. These cooperations have actually led to boosted local scientific productivity and added meaningfully to the advancement of the broader bioinformatics neighborhood in Brazil.

From an instructional viewpoint, the teaching strategy used in the training was deliberately interactive. Courses were carried out in a fashion that urged pupil involvement and conversation, exceeding memorizing memorization to explore exactly how ideas are created, used in daily life, and checked in scholastic settings. The educational philosophy concentrated on nurturing both solid and struggling pupils, giving customized assistance, and building confidence through sustained mentorship and patience.

Each group, including about 36 participants, was supported by 3 coaches-- a lot of whom were postdoctoral scientists with specific knowledge. These advisors not just aided make the group jobs yet also promoted their implementation, making sure that each research concern was both properly difficult and appropriate. The objective was to give a naturally reasonable context that individuals could check out via open-ended purposes and accessibility to curated datasets.
